Key Features to Look For

You need to think about what you want in a dog. Here are some important things to consider:

  • Size: How big is your space? A tiny apartment needs a small dog. A big house can handle a larger breed.
  • Energy Level: Are you an active person? A high-energy dog needs lots of exercise. A calmer dog might suit a more relaxed lifestyle.
  • Grooming Needs: Some dogs need a lot of brushing. Others need professional grooming. Think about how much time you want to spend on grooming.
  • Temperament: Do you have kids? Do you have other pets? Some dogs are better with children and other animals than others.
  • Lifespan: Dogs live for many years. Be ready to care for them for their whole life.

Dog Pet FAQs

Q: What are the best breeds for families with kids?

A: Labrador Retrievers, Golden Retrievers, and Beagles are often great choices.

Q: How much exercise does a dog need?

A: It depends on the breed and age. Most dogs need at least 30 minutes to an hour of exercise each day.

Q: How often should I feed my dog?

A: Puppies need to eat more often than adult dogs. Most adult dogs eat twice a day.

Q: How do I stop my dog from chewing things?

A: Give your dog plenty of chew toys. Make sure they get enough exercise. Training can help too.

Q: What should I do if my dog is scared of something?

A: Comfort your dog. Don’t force them to face their fear. Slowly expose them to the thing they are scared of.

Q: How do I train my dog to sit?

A: Hold a treat near their nose. Move it over their head. As their head goes up, their bottom will go down. Say “Sit” and give them the treat.

Q: What are some common dog health problems?

A: Hip dysplasia, allergies, and dental problems are common.

Q: How do I choose a good dog food?

A: Look for food that is high-quality. Talk to your vet. They can recommend a good food for your dog.

Q: How do I keep my dog’s teeth clean?

A: Brush your dog’s teeth regularly. Give them dental chews. Your vet can also clean their teeth.

Q: What should I do if my dog gets lost?

A: Put up signs. Contact your local animal shelters. Use social media. Make sure your dog has a microchip!
